  • the present invention relates to a centrifugal impeller used for ventilation and ventilation equipment and air conditioning equipment and the like, and a centrifugal blower using the same.
  • the centrifugal fan 101 has a casing 107, a centrifugal impeller 112 having a multi-blade impeller shape, and an electric motor 113.
  • the casing 107 has a suction plate 103, a back plate 104 facing the suction plate 103, and a side wall 106.
  • the casing 107 is configured by sandwiching the suction plate 103, the back plate 104 and the force side wall 106.
  • the suction plate 103 has a bell mouth-like suction port 102.
  • Side wall 106 has a spiral shape and has an outlet 105.
  • the centrifugal impeller 112 is provided inside the casing 107 and has an annular side plate 108, a main plate 110, and a plurality of blades 111.
  • the main plate 110 has a throttling portion 109.
  • the throttling portion 109 has a cone shape which is convex toward the side plate 108 side.
  • a centrifugal impeller 112 is configured by sandwiching the side plate 108, the main plate 110, and the force blade 111.
  • a centrifugal impeller 112 is connected to the rotating shaft 114 of the motor 113.
  • the motor 113 is attached to the back plate 104.
  • Such a centrifugal fan 101 is disclosed, for example, in Japanese Patent No. 3629690 (referred to as Patent Document 1).
  • the centrifugal fan 101 has the above-described configuration, and the centrifugal impeller 112 is rotated by applying a driving force from the electric motor 113 to the rotating shaft 114. As the centrifugal impeller 112 rotates, suction air 115 passes through the suction port 102, flows into the blade 111, and is pressurized. Further, the suction air 115 flows out of the blade 111, gradually converts from dynamic pressure to static pressure when passing through the casing 107, and is discharged from the discharge port 105 to the outside. Ru. At this time, the pressure of the flow 116 flowing out of the blade 111 and passing through the casing 107 is high.
  • Ventilation holes 118 are provided in the main plate 110 in order to prevent the backflow 117 from stagnating in a stagnant state and lowering the air blowing performance of the centrifugal air blower 101.
  • the provision of the vent holes 118 forms a circulating flow 119 which flows back into the reverse flow 117 force S blade 111.
  • the vent holes 118 prevent the suction air 115 from colliding with the throttling portion 109 and flowing into the blade 111. Further, the vent holes 118 guide the suction air 115 and the circulating flow 11 9 to the motor 113 to promote cooling of the motor 113.

  • a centrifugal impeller 14 and a centrifugal fan 1 according to Embodiment 1 of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S. 1 and 2.
  • a centrifugal blower 1 (hereinafter referred to as a blower 1) ) Has an outer shell 5, a casing 10, a discharge port 11, a motor 13 and a centrifugal impeller 14 (hereinafter referred to as an impeller 14).
  • the outer shell 5 has an open lower surface 2 and a duct connection opening 4 (hereinafter referred to as an opening 4) on the side surface 3.
  • the size of the outer shell 5 is 258 mm square and the height is 198 mm.
  • the casing 10 has a suction plate 7, a back plate 8 and a side wall 9 provided in the outer shell 5, and the casing 10 is configured by sandwiching the side wall 9 with the suction plate 7 and the back plate 8.
  • the suction plate 7 has a suction port 6 having a bell mouth shape.
  • the inside diameter Do of the suction port 6 is 148 mm.
  • the back plate 8 has a flat plate shape facing the suction plate 7.
  • the side wall 9 has a spiral shape and has a height He of 107 mm.
  • the discharge port 11 is provided in the side wall 9 and communicates with the opening 4.
  • the motor 13 has a rotating shaft 12 provided concentrically with the suction port 6 and is fixed to the back plate 8.
  • the size of the motor 13 is 75 mm in diameter and 80 mm in height.
  • the impeller 14 has a multi-wing shape and is fixed to the rotation shaft 12 of the motor 13. Due to the multi-blade shape of the impeller 14, the blower 1 is small in size and has high pressure and low noise characteristics. These features are required for ventilation and ventilation equipment.
  • a duct 50 is provided outside the opening 4. Further, the tongue portion 42 is formed at a portion including the minimum gap between the outer peripheral portion of the impeller 14 and the casing 10.
  • the blower 1 is used, for example, as an in-ceiling recessed ventilation fan mounted on a ceiling to ventilate a bathroom or a space such as a toilet.
  • the impeller 14 has a main plate 15, blades 18, an annular plate 20 and a cylindrical wall 22.
  • the main plate 15 has a disk shape having an outer diameter Dm of 182 mm and a thickness of 3 mm.
  • Ventilation holes 16 are disposed on the main plate 15 so that air can pass through the main plate 15.
  • six ventilation holes 16 are annularly provided.
  • Fifty blades of 18 force S are joined at the joint portion 15b on the outer peripheral side of the front side surface 17 of the main plate 15, and are arranged at equal intervals in a ring shape. Due to this, the blade 18 forms a multi-bladed impeller shape having a blade inner peripheral portion 18a and a blade outer peripheral portion 18b.
  • the blade 18 has the same outer diameter Dbo of the outer peripheral portion 18b of the blade 18 as the outer diameter Dm of the main plate 15 of 182 mm, and the inner diameter Dbi of the blade inner peripheral portion 18a is the inner diameter Do of the suction port 6 of 148 mm It has the same dimensions and a blade height Hb of 77 mm.
  • the annular plate 20 is attached to the outer periphery of the tip 19 of the blade 18.
  • the outer diameter Dr of the annular plate 20 is 191. 5 mm and the height is 3 mm.
  • the cylindrical wall 22 is the back of the main plate 15
  • the side plate 21 is provided concentrically with the main plate 15.
  • the cylindrical wall 22 has an outer diameter Dwo of 182 mm having the same dimension as the blade outer diameter Dbo, and a height Hw of 27 mm which is at least 30% and at most 40% of the height Hb of the blade 18 , Thickness is 2 mm.
  • the gap 24 between the tip 23 of the cylindrical wall 22 and the back plate 8 is 3 mm.
  • the central portion 25a of the main plate 15 protrudes 30 mm to the suction port 6 side.
  • the main plate 15 has a main plate projecting portion 15a that protrudes in a cone shape that inclines gently from the central portion 25a toward the outer peripheral portion 25b.
  • the vent holes 16 have a fan-like shape substantially viewed in the axial direction.
  • the outer diameter Dh of the ventilation holes 16 is 145 mm, which is the same size as the inner diameter Dbi of the blade. Further, the area on the outer peripheral portion 25b side from the ventilation hole 16 of the main plate 15, that is, the joint 15b is inclined radially outward from the outer peripheral edge 31 of the ventilation hole 16 to the cylindrical wall 22 side. That is, the joint portion 15b is inclined toward the cylindrical wall 22 as it goes radially outward.
  • the front side surface 17 of the main plate 15 is the side facing the inlet 6 of the main plate 15, and the back side 21 of the main plate 15 is the side facing the back plate 8 of the main plate 15.
  • the motor 13 penetrates the motor hole 26 of the back plate 8, and a half of the motor 13 protrudes into the casing 10 and is contained inside the cylindrical wall 22.
  • the main plate 15 has a cone shape, the motor 13 does not come in contact with the impeller 14.
  • suction air 27 is sucked from the tip 19 side and flows out from the blade 18.
  • the stream 28 flowing out of the blade 18 runs obliquely.
  • a cylindrical wall 22 concentric with the main plate 15 is provided on the back surface 21.
  • the flow of the fluid flowing out of the blade 18 is suppressed to the back side 21 side. For this reason, the flow receives frictional force from the back side 21 and the flow is not disturbed.
  • the impeller 14 and the blower 1 the decrease in the blowing efficiency is suppressed.
  • the cylindrical wall 22 is also rotating. As a result, a rotational force is applied to the flow 28 flowing out of the blade 18 by the frictional force with which the cylindrical wall 22 rotates. As a result, the blowing efficiency between the impeller 14 and the blower 1 is improved.
  • the pressure of the flow out of the blade 18 through the casing 10 is high.
  • a reverse flow 29 is generated which flows into the gap 24 between the partial force impeller 14 and the back plate 8 of the flow 28 flowing out of the blade 18.
  • the cylindrical wall 22 concentric with the main plate 15 is provided on the back side 21 while the force is applied, the amount of the backflow 29 is reduced.
  • the ventilation holes 16 are provided in the main plate 15, so that stagnation of the backflow 29 in a stagnant state is suppressed, and a decrease in the air blowing performance of the blower 1 is prevented.
  • the ventilation holes 16 prevent the suction air 27 from colliding with the main plate 15 and flowing into the blades 18. Further, the suction air 27 or the circulation flow 30 is introduced to the motor 13 to promote the cooling of the motor 13.
  • a partial force of the flow 28 flowing out of the blade 18 forms a reverse flow 29 of the flow 28 and passes through the vent holes 16 to form a circulating flow 30 flowing into the blade 18 again.
  • the backflow 29 occurs at a location away from the blade 18.
  • the collision of the flow 28 flowing out of the blade 18 and the reverse flow 29 in the vicinity of the main plate 15 of the blade 18 is avoided.
  • the vicinity of the main plate 15 of the blade 18 performs effective work, and a decrease in the blowing efficiency of the blower 1 is suppressed.
  • the collision between the flow 28 and the backflow 29 Generation of turbulent noise due to That is, the blower 1 and the impeller 14 improve the blowing efficiency and reduce the noise.
  • the joint portion 15b where the main plate 15 and the blade 18 are joined to the outer peripheral portion 25b side from the ventilating hole 16 is directed radially outward from the outer peripheral edge 31, and inclined toward the cylindrical wall 22 side. doing. That is, the joint portion 15b is inclined toward the cylindrical wall 22 as the radial outward force is applied. This causes the flow area to gradually expand while the suction air 27 passes through the blade 18, and the flow 28 rapidly expands after flowing out of the blade 18. Therefore, the occurrence of flow expansion loss is suppressed. As a result, the blowing efficiency of the blower 1 is improved.
  • the height Hw of the cylindrical wall 22 is 30% or more and 40% or less of the blade height Hb.
  • the cylindrical wall 22 has a high effect of avoiding the collision between the flow 28 and the backflow 29.
  • the blowing efficiency between the impeller 14 and the blower 1 is improved, and the noise is reduced.
  • the impeller 14 and the blower 1 can be obtained which are reduced in size.

  • a centrifugal fan 1 according to a fourth embodiment of the present invention is provided with a lid 37 for closing a space 36 surrounded by the inner cylindrical wall 33 and the outer cylindrical wall 32.
  • the lid 37 has a width corresponding to the distance between the wall 32 and the wall 33 in the radial direction of the main plate 15.
  • FIG. 7 shows a centrifugal impeller 14 and a centrifugal fan 1 according to Embodiment 5 of the present invention.
  • the same components as in the first to fourth embodiments will be assigned the same reference numerals and detailed explanations thereof will be omitted.
  • an inner cylindrical wall 33 is formed of a perforated plate 39.
  • the perforated plate 39 has a large number of small holes 38 with a diameter of 5 mm and has an aperture ratio of 10%, and is made of, for example, a hard fiber board.
  • Blower 1 is provided with a perforated plate 39 to form a perforated plate sound absorption structure. That is, the air remaining in the small holes 38 of the perforated plate 39 becomes a mass component, and the space 36 surrounded by the wall 33, the wall 32 and the lid 37 becomes a back air layer to form a vibration system. As a result, a perforated plate sound absorbing structure is formed that absorbs sound on the same principle as a Helmholtz resonator, which is a type of resonant sound absorbing structure. As a result, noise in the vicinity of the impeller 14 is silenced, and the noise of the blower 1 is reduced.

  • FIG. 11 shows a centrifugal impeller 14 and a centrifugal fan 1 according to Embodiment 9 of the present invention.
  • the back plate 8 has a main portion 43 and a spiral plate 44.
  • the main portion 43 is joined to the end 9 a of the side wall 9.
  • the helical plate 44 has a helical shape which is inclined helically from the tongue 42 toward the discharge port 11. Furthermore, the height He of the side wall 9 gradually expands from the vicinity of the tongue 42 toward the discharge port 11. That is, the helical plate 44 has an axial position (height And has an axial position (height H) equivalent to that of the cylindrical wall 22 near the discharge port 11.
  • the blower 1 has the spiral plate 44 inclined from the tongue 42 toward the discharge port 11. For this reason, the flow 28 flowing out of the blade 18 collides with the spiral plate 44, whereby the flow direction changes in the direction of the discharge port 11. As a result, the blowing efficiency of the blower 1 is improved. Further, the spiral plate 44 has a position in the vicinity of the discharge port 11 equivalent to the axial position of the cylindrical wall 22. For this reason, the height in the rotational axis direction of the blower 1 is miniaturized. Furthermore, a spiral plate 44 is composed of the main body 43 and a separate part. As a result, the main body 43 is formed into a simple structure, such as a flat plate, for example, and the spiral plate 44 is also easily made of a flat plate as well. For this reason, the structure of the back plate 8 is simplified, and the manufacturing cost of the impeller 14 and the blower 1 is reduced.

Abstract

L'objet de la présente invention concerne une roue centrifuge (14) et un ventilateur centrifuge (1) qui comprend une plaque principale (15), des pales (18), une plaque annulaire (20) et une paroi cylindrique (22). Les pales (18) sont disposées de manière annulaire sur la partie périphérique externe de la surface avant (17) de la plaque principale (15). La plaque annulaire (20) est fixée aux extrémités (19) des pales (18). La paroi cylindrique (22) est ainsi sur la surface arrière (21) de la plaque principale (15) de manière à être disposée coaxialement par rapport à la plaque principale (15). De cette manière, on obtient une roue centrifuge (14) et un ventilateur centrifuge (1) dont l'efficacité du souffle d'air est augmentée tout en ayant une diminution du bruit créé.
